About 11-hydroxypentadec-2-enoic acid
11-hydroxypentadec-2-enoic acid (PubChem CID 162983544) has the molecular formula C15H28O3
and a molecular weight of 256.39 g/mol. Its IUPAC name is 11-hydroxypentadec-2-enoic acid.
Molecular Properties
| Compound Name | 11-hydroxypentadec-2-enoic acid |
| PubChem CID | 162983544 |
| Molecular Formula | C15H28O3 |
| Molecular Weight | 256.39 g/mol |
| Exact Mass | 256.20 |
| IUPAC Name | 11-hydroxypentadec-2-enoic acid |
| SMILES | CCCCC(O)CCCCCCCC=CC(=O)O |
| InChI | InChI=1S/C15H28O3/c1-2-3-11-14(16)12-9-7-5-4-6-8-10-13-15(17)18/h10,13-14,16H,2-9,11-12H2,1H3,(H,17,18) |
| InChIKey | DBALKFBBBMINSS-UHFFFAOYSA-N |
| XLogP | 3.91 |
| TPSA | 57.53 Ų |
| H-Bond Donors | 2 |
| H-Bond Acceptors | 2 |
| Rotatable Bonds | 12 |
| Heavy Atoms | 18 |
| Complexity | — |
